The Origins of CBD Cannabis
CBD cannabis has a rich history that spans centuries and continents. The use of cannabis for medicinal purposes can be traced back to ancient civilizations in Asia, where it was valued for its therapeutic properties. From there, the plant traveled along trade routes to various parts of the world, including Africa and Europe.
In the 19th century, scientists began isolating compounds from cannabis plants, leading to the discovery of CBD. However, it wasn’t until recent years that CBD gained mainstream popularity for its potential health benefits. Today, CBD cannabis products come in various forms, such as oils, gummies, and topical creams.

Understanding the Endocannabinoid System
The endocannabinoid system (ECS) is a complex network of receptors found throughout the human body. Its primary role is to help regulate physiological functions like mood, pain sensation, appetite, and memory. The ECS consists of three key components: endocannabinoids, cannabinoid receptors, and enzymes.
Endocannabinoids are molecules the body produces that interact with cannabinoid receptors to signal the ECS. Cannabinoid receptors on cell surfaces respond to endocannabinoids and external cannabinoids like CBD. Enzymes are responsible for breaking down endocannabinoids after they have carried out their function.
When CBD interacts with the ECS, it can help support overall balance within the body by influencing how other neurotransmitters and systems operate. This interaction may contribute to the potential health benefits associated with CBD consumption. Health Benefits of CBD Cannabis
CBD cannabis offers a wide range of health benefits that can improve the quality of life for many individuals. From managing chronic pain and reducing inflammation to alleviating symptoms of anxiety and depression, CBD has shown promising results in various studies. Additionally, its neuroprotective properties may have potential applications in treating neurological disorders like epilepsy and multiple sclerosis.
